How to Contact Your Test Administrator for Assistance During an Assessment

If you're a candidate taking an assessment and need help or clarification, the test administrator is your go-to contact. They can assist with any issues or queries related to the test, test details, or any clarifications you might need.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you reach out to your test administrator.

Steps to Contact Your Test Administrator

  1. Open the Invite Email:
    Start by opening the email invite you received for the assessment. If you don’t see it in your inbox, check your spam or junk folder.

  2. Locate the Test Administrator Email:
    In the invite email, locate the "Test Administrator" section. This is where you will find the email of the person responsible for handling any test-related queries.

  3. Copy the Email:
    Hover your mouse over the Test Administrator's email address. Right-click on the Administrator and select “Copy Email Address.”

  4. Compose Your Email:
    Compose a new email, and paste the Test Administrator’s email into the recipient field. You can either write a new email addressing your issue or include the Test Administrator in an ongoing email thread.

  5. Send Your Query:
    Clearly state your concern or question in the email and send it to the Test Administrator. They will assist you with your queries as soon as possible.

FAQs:

Q: What should I do if I don’t receive an invite email?
A: Check your spam or junk folder. If it’s not there, reach out to the person who scheduled the assessment or [email protected] for assistance.

Q: Can I reach out to the test administrator for any test-related queries?
A: Yes, the Test Administrator is your point of contact for all test-related questions, including technical issues and test details.

Q: How soon will I get a response from the Test Administrator?
A: Response times can vary, but typically you should hear back within 1–2 business days.
